2024 is a busy year for the MBTA Communities Zoning Law in Massachusetts
177 communities are required to adopt a by right multifamily zoning district. 12 communities had a deadline in 2023, 130 have a deadline in 2024, and the remaining 35 have a deadline in 2025.
